Systems and methods for an iot device registry that provides for dynamic trust ratings of registered devices

US2025104098A1 · US · A1

Patent metadata
FieldValue
Publication numberUS-2025104098-A1
Application numberUS-202418970289-A
CountryUS
Kind codeA1
Filing dateDec 5, 2024
Priority dateApr 16, 2021
Publication dateMar 27, 2025
Grant date

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

A method for determining a trust indicator is provided. The method may include interpreting, via an Internet of Things Universal Identifier (IoT UID) processing circuit, an IoT UID corresponding to a device and identifying, via a record management circuit and based at least in part on the IoT UID, a record in a database corresponding to the device. The method may further include determining, via a trust analysis circuit and based at least in part on the record, a risk indicator of the device and transmitting, via an indicator provisioning circuit, the risk indicator.

First claim

Opening claim text (preview).

What is claimed is: 1 . An apparatus comprising: an Internet of Things Universal Identifier (IoT UID) processing circuit structured to interpret an IoT UID corresponding to a device, wherein the IoT UID is generated based at least in part on device property data, corresponding to the device, to provide a Seed of Trust; a trust verification circuit structured to generate a trust indicator request value that includes the IoT UID corresponding to the device; a trust indicator request provisioning circuit structured to transmit the trust indicator request value to an IoT device registrar server; and a trust indicator processing circuit structured to interpret a trust indicator generated by the IoT device registrar server based at least in part on the Seed of Trust and in response to the trust indicator request value. 2 . The apparatus of claim 1 , wherein the trust indicator is based at least in part on at least one of a location of the device, a time period, a software, or firmware version of the device. 3 . The apparatus of claim 1 , wherein the trust indicator processing circuit is further structured to authorize an interaction with the device based at least in part on the trust indicator. 4 . The apparatus of claim 1 , wherein the trust indicator processing circuit is further structured to prohibit an interaction with the device based at least in part on the trust indicator. 5 . The apparatus of claim 1 , wherein the trust indicator comprises a numeric value. 6 . The apparatus the apparatus of claim 1 , wherein the trust indicator is reflective of the device being a Greenfield device or a Brownfield device. 7 . A non-transitory computer-readable medium storing instructions that, when loaded into at least one processor, cause the at least one processor to: interpret an IoT UID corresponding to a device, wherein the IoT UID is generated based at least in part on device property data, corresponding to the device, to provide a Seed of Trust; identify, based at least in part on the IoT UID, a record in a database corresponding to the device; determine, based at least in part on the record and the Seed of Trust, a risk indicator of the device; and transmit the risk indicator. 8 . The non-transitory computer-readable medium of claim 7 , wherein the risk indicator is a numeric value. 9 . The non-transitory computer-readable medium of claim 7 , wherein the risk indicator is displayed as a color-coded value. 10 . The non-transitory computer-readable medium of claim 7 , wherein the risk indicator is based at least in part on at least one of a location of the device, a time period, a software, or firmware version of the device. 11 . The non-transitory computer-readable medium of claim 7 , wherein the risk indicator is reflective of the device being a Greenfield device or a Brownfield device. 12 . The non-transitory computer-readable medium of claim 7 , wherein the stored instructions further cause the at least one processor to: authorize an interaction with the device based at least in part on the risk indicator. 13 . The non-transitory computer-readable medium of claim 7 , wherein the stored instructions further cause the at least one processor to: prohibit an interaction with the device based at least in part on the risk indicator. 14 . The non-transitory computer-readable medium of claim 13 , wherein the interaction is an exchange of data with the device or is establishing a network connection with the device. 15 . The non-transitory computer-readable medium of claim 7 , wherein the stored instructions further cause the at least one processor to: adjust the risk indicator based on an event of the device, wherein the event is at least one of a transfer of ownership, patching of the device, or an updating of a software and/or a firmware of the device. 16 . The non-transitory computer-readable medium of claim 7 , wherein the stored instructions further cause the at least one processor to: interpret a device event message and updating the record in an IoT device registry based at least in part on the device event message. 17 . A non-transitory computer-readable medium storing instructions that, when loaded into at least one processor, cause the at least one processor to: interpret an IoT UID corresponding to a device, wherein the IoT UID is generated based at least in part on device property data, corresponding to the device, to provide a Seed of Trust; generate a trust indicator request value that includes the IoT UID corresponding to the device; transmit the trust indicator request value to an IoT device registrar server; and interpret a trust indicator generated by the IoT device registrar server based at least in part on the Seed of Trust and in response to the trust indicator request value. 18 . The non-transitory computer-readable medium of claim 17 , wherein the trust indicator is based at least in part on at least one of a location of the device, a time period, a software, or firmware version of the device. 19 . The non-transitory computer-readable medium of claim 17 , wherein the stored instructions further cause the at least one processor to: authorize an interaction with the device based at least in part on the trust indicator. 20 . The non-transitory computer-readable medium of claim 17 , wherein the stored instructions further cause the at least one processor to: prohibit an interaction with the device based at least in part on the trust indicator.

Assignees

Inventors

Classifications

  • specially adapted for proprietary or special-purpose networking environments, e.g. medical networks, sensor networks, networks in vehicles or remote metering networks · CPC title

  • the source of the received data · CPC title

  • by checking functioning · CPC title

  • characterised by the conditions triggering a change of settings · CPC title

  • for initial configuration or provisioning, e.g. plug-and-play ·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US2025104098A1 cover?
A method for determining a trust indicator is provided. The method may include interpreting, via an Internet of Things Universal Identifier (IoT UID) processing circuit, an IoT UID corresponding to a device and identifying, via a record management circuit and based at least in part on the IoT UID, a record in a database corresponding to the device. The method may further include determining, vi…
Who is the assignee on this patent?
Somos Inc
What technology area does this patent fall under?
Primary CPC classification G06Q30/018. Mapped technology areas include Physics.
When was this patent published?
Publication date Thu Mar 27 2025 00:00:00 GMT+0000 (Coordinated Universal Time) (A1).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 2 related publications on this page (citations in our corpus or others sharing the same primary CPC).